Transaction 89435db5222838822794c468c44843e789caa93befa79a2ae11a31e4e340275c
1 Input
1 Output
-
89435db5222838822794c468c44843e789caa93befa79a2ae11a31e4e340275c:0
- value
- 1318006
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 960aaf4c66407b9d5ad35513883659a25d67b18e OP_EQUAL
- address
- 3FNN5i3PRNS8nmKenoW671dLAX4oH1u6dz